So, it’s a seamless transition – when I give them basic general information and a photo, they can put it together well.” GRI’s number one priority for the future is to keep growing. Bourgeois confirms, “We want to be a $250 million per year company within the next five years, with offices all throughout the Gulf coast and up the east coast. The idea is to expand and take over more market control. We’ve grown from a $30 million per year company in 2016 to $100 million, now. The primary reasons for that are the growth of our sales teams, and we’ve hired high-level management to develop our divisions; the procedures, the processes that go on when we execute the work. Sales and execution go hand in hand.” Technically speaking, GRI is an industrial mechanical contractor that specializes in ASME pressure vessels and API tanks, among a multitude of other construction, maintenance, and EPC services.
